From 48baabbb0e832b3bcbed5bd31a582c247fa9faee Mon Sep 17 00:00:00 2001 From: Bruno Haible Date: Sat, 30 Sep 2023 20:38:29 +0200 Subject: [PATCH] intl: Merge from glibc. Apply commit 2019-09-05 Florian Weimer locale: Avoid zero-length array in _nl_category_names [BZ #24962] --- gettext-runtime/intl/dcigettext.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/gettext-runtime/intl/dcigettext.c b/gettext-runtime/intl/dcigettext.c index a90b509bd..8e7db219f 100644 --- a/gettext-runtime/intl/dcigettext.c +++ b/gettext-runtime/intl/dcigettext.c @@ -329,8 +329,7 @@ static const char *guess_category_value (int category, #ifdef _LIBC # include "../locale/localeinfo.h" -# define category_to_name(category) \ - _nl_category_names.str + _nl_category_name_idxs[category] +# define category_to_name(category) _nl_category_names_get (category) #else static const char *category_to_name (int category); #endif -- 2.47.3